Output 2826055649ed51aec1604dd60a3b61b98b3feb91d87c082a43cc39669b05e53b:3

value
738789
script pubkey
OP_0 OP_PUSHBYTES_32 cc104b134eb123837f4894eb16175626f90aa8ceb51ada36fec496f23cad9a55
address
bc1qesgyky6wky3cxl6gjn43v96kymus42xwk5dd5dh7cjt0y09dnf2smp5gtv
transaction
2826055649ed51aec1604dd60a3b61b98b3feb91d87c082a43cc39669b05e53b
spent
true